Home
last modified time | relevance | path

Searched refs:pin_banks (Results 1 – 8 of 8) sorted by relevance

/linux/drivers/pinctrl/samsung/
H A Dpinctrl-exynos-arm.c145 .pin_banks = s5pv210_pin_bank,
228 .pin_banks = exynos3250_pin_banks0,
236 .pin_banks = exynos3250_pin_banks1,
340 .pin_banks = exynos4210_pin_banks0,
348 .pin_banks = exynos4210_pin_banks1,
357 .pin_banks = exynos4210_pin_banks2,
437 .pin_banks = exynos4x12_pin_banks0,
445 .pin_banks = exynos4x12_pin_banks1,
454 .pin_banks = exynos4x12_pin_banks2,
462 .pin_banks = exynos4x12_pin_banks3,
[all …]
H A Dpinctrl-s3c64xx.c476 bank = d->pin_banks; in s3c64xx_eint_gpio_init()
503 bank = d->pin_banks; in s3c64xx_eint_gpio_init()
739 bank = d->pin_banks; in s3c64xx_eint_eint0_init()
809 .pin_banks = s3c64xx_pin_banks0,
H A Dpinctrl-exynos.c341 struct samsung_pin_bank *bank = d->pin_banks; in exynos_eint_gpio_irq()
433 bank = d->pin_banks; in exynos_eint_gpio_init()
793 bank = d->pin_banks; in exynos_eint_wkup_init()
859 bank = d->pin_banks; in exynos_eint_wkup_init()
/linux/drivers/pinctrl/nuvoton/
H A Dpinctrl-ma35.c122 struct ma35_pin_bank *pin_banks; member
508 struct ma35_pin_bank *bank = ctrl->pin_banks; in ma35_gpiolib_register()
585 ctrl->pin_banks = devm_kcalloc(&pdev->dev, ctrl->nr_banks, in ma35_pinctrl_get_soc_data()
586 sizeof(*ctrl->pin_banks), GFP_KERNEL); in ma35_pinctrl_get_soc_data()
587 if (!ctrl->pin_banks) in ma35_pinctrl_get_soc_data()
591 ctrl->pin_banks[i].bank_num = i; in ma35_pinctrl_get_soc_data()
592 ctrl->pin_banks[i].name = gpio_group_name[i]; in ma35_pinctrl_get_soc_data()
596 bank = &ctrl->pin_banks[id]; in ma35_pinctrl_get_soc_data()
622 base = npctl->ctrl->pin_banks[group_num].reg_base; in ma35_pinconf_set_pull()
654 base = npctl->ctrl->pin_banks[group_num].reg_base; in ma35_pinconf_get_output()
[all …]
/linux/drivers/pinctrl/
H A Dpinctrl-rockchip.c337 struct rockchip_pin_bank *b = info->ctrl->pin_banks; in pin_to_bank()
349 struct rockchip_pin_bank *b = info->ctrl->pin_banks; in bank_num_to_bank()
3987 pin_bank = &info->ctrl->pin_banks[bank]; in rockchip_pinctrl_register()
4035 bank = ctrl->pin_banks; in rockchip_pinctrl_get_soc_data()
4267 bank = &info->ctrl->pin_banks[i]; in rockchip_pinctrl_remove()
4304 .pin_banks = px30_pin_banks,
4328 .pin_banks = rv1108_pin_banks,
4368 .pin_banks = rv1126_pin_banks,
4391 .pin_banks = rk2928_pin_banks,
4406 .pin_banks = rk3036_pin_banks,
[all …]
H A Dpinctrl-equilibrium.c285 bank = &pctl->pin_banks[i]; in find_pinbank_via_pin()
799 nr_pins += drvdata->pin_banks[i].nr_pins; in pinctrl_reg()
912 drvdata->pin_banks = banks; in pinbank_probe()
H A Dpinctrl-rockchip.h393 struct rockchip_pin_bank *pin_banks; member
/linux/drivers/gpio/
H A Dgpio-rockchip.c699 bank = info->ctrl->pin_banks; in rockchip_gpio_find_bank()